**Action Item: FD Leak Hunt, Round Two.** So, the Copperwick host ran out of file descriptors again, and this time the culprit was a plugin holding sockets open after teardown. If you ship plugins for the Marlin runtime, please double-check that your shutdown hooks actually close what you open — the runtime won't do it for you. We've added a leak detector to the test harness. Setup instructions and examples are on the page below.

dashboard of yahaf-kajep = https://jira.zemvarsys.internal/display/projects/browse/browse/a08b

Management Meeting Minutes — Distribution to Branch Managers, Calveth Foods

1. Single supplier exposure on packaging (Ridgemoor Containers) reviewed; lead-time slippage continues.
2. Second-source search underway; four candidates identified, two invited for audits.
3. Branches to report any local supplier contacts worth evaluating by Friday.
4. No change to ordering procedures until qualification completes.
5. Cost delta expected under 3%; absorbed centrally.

Next update at the monthly call. Confidential planning context follows below.

internal memo for bahap-yagug: Headcount on the Ulaix team goes from 3 to 100 by the end of January. Gross margin on Ulaix came in at 10 percent against a plan of 15 percent.

Before approving a channel promotion for Wrenfield devices, confirm the rollout gate: staging soak must exceed 48 hours with zero watchdog resets reported. Verify the manifest's minimum-version field matches the release sheet, since a mismatch bricks recovery mode on older boards. Once both checks pass, record the promoted build identifier below for the audit trail.

pipeline stamp: htk31_f769b577b3028a4e9958e5bb8d1259a

**Vendor note: Inkmill markdown pipeline**

Rendering for Parchway docs is outsourced to Inkmill under an annual contract, renewing each March. They handle sanitization and PDF export; we own the upload queue. SLA: 4-hour response on rendering failures. Escalate only after two failed retries. Their support desk is reachable at the address below.

billing contact of hahaf-baguf = zorael.tammir.jorius@sivrelhq.internal